Block Diagram
NOTES:
1. Port pins are software configurable with pullup device if input port.
2. Pin contains pullup/pulldown device if IRQ enabled (IRQPE = 1).
3. IRQ does not have a clamp diode to VDD. IRQ should not be driven above VDD.
4. Pin contains integrated pullup device.
5. High current drive
6. Pins PTA[7:4] contain both pullup and pulldown devices. Pulldown available when KBI enabled (KBIPn = 1).

Description
The MC9S08GT16A is one of the members of the low-cost, high-performance HCS08 Family of 8-bit microcontroller units (MCUs). All MCUs in the family use the enhanced HCS08 core and are available with a variety of modules, memory sizes, memory types, and package types.
Features
8-Bit HCS08 Central Processor Unit (CPU)
• 40-MHz HCS08 CPU
• HC08 instruction set with added BGND instruction
• Support for up to 32 interrupt/reset sources
Memory Options
• FLASH read/program/erase down to 1.8 V
• Up to 16K FLASH; up to 2K RAM
Power-Saving Modes
• Three very low power stop modes
• Reduced power wait mode
• Very low power real time interrupt for use in run, wait, and stop
Clock Source Options
• Clock sources to internal hardware frequency locked-loop (FLL): internal, external, crystal, or resonator
• Internal clock with ±0.2% trimming resolution and ±0.5% deviation across voltage or across temperature
System Protection
• Optional watchdog computer operating properly (COP) reset
• Low-voltage detection with reset or interrupt
• Illegal opcode detection with reset
• Illegal address detection with reset
• FLASH block protect and security
Peripherals
• ATD — 8-channel, 10-bit analog-to-digital converter
• SCI — Two serial communications interface modules
• SPI — Serial peripheral interface module
• IIC — Inter-integrated circuit bus module
• Timer —One 3-channel timer PWM module (TPM) plus one 2-channel TPM
• KBI — 8-pin keyboard interrupt module
Input/Output
• 8 high-current pins (20 mA each)
• Software selectable pullups on ports when used as input
• Internal pullup on RESET and IRQ pin to reduce customer system cost
• Up to 38 general-purpose input/output (I/O) pins, plus one output-only pin, depending on package selection
Development Support
• Background debugging system
• Breakpoint capability to allow single breakpoint setting during in-circuit debugging (plus two more breakpoints in on-chip debug module)
• On-chip, in-circuit emulation (ICE) debug module with real-time bus capture. On-chip ICE debug module containing two comparators and nine trigger modes. Eight deep FIFO for storing change-of-flow addresses and event-only data.
• Single-wire background debug interface
Package Options
• 48-pin QFN
• 44-pin QFP
• 42-pin PSDIP
• 32-pin QFN
